原文:spring jdbc查询时使用IN()的技巧

在使用SELECT查询时IN比OR的效率好。那么在Spring中如何使用IN 呢 这是我原来的使用方式,用字符串拼接: StringBuilder buf new StringBuilder SELECT name FROM pos user WHERE id IN ids 是List lt Integer gt 类型 for int i i lt ids.size i if i gt buf.a ...

2022-02-07 15:46 0 884 推荐指数:

查看详情

使用jdbc拼接条件查询语句如何防止sql注入

本人微信公众号,欢迎扫码关注! 使用jdbc拼接条件查询语句如何防止sql注入 最近公司的项目在上线需要进行安全扫描,但是有几个项目中含有部分老代码,操作数据库使用的是jdbc,并且竟然好多都是拼接的SQL语句,真是令人抓狂。 在具体改造,必须使用 ...

Sun Apr 28 05:49:00 CST 2019 0 3483
Spring JDBC实现查询

1 db.properties 2 applicationContext.xml 3 com.spring.jdbc 实体类 EmployeeDao.java ...

Fri Dec 23 08:05:00 CST 2016 0 2492
Spring JDBC使用

1、为什么使用Spring提供的JDBC的封装?   因为Spring提供了完整的模板类以及基类可以简化开发,我们只需写少量的代码即可。 2、实例讲解 第一步:导入依赖  mysql-connector spring-jdbc spring-tx spring ...

Mon Sep 09 04:39:00 CST 2019 1 308
Spring JDBC 的简单使用

Spring框架对JDBC的简单封装。提供了一个JDBCTemplate对象简化JDBC的开发。 使用步骤 导入架包:commons-logging-1.2.jar、spring-beans-5.0.0.RELEASE.jar、spring ...

Thu Feb 20 07:59:00 CST 2020 0 3453
mysql日期和JDBC查询出来的结果相差8小

数据库时间:2017-11-08 16:30:00 查询出来: 2017-11-09 00:30:00 问题:数据库时区,和JDBC连接时区设置问题。 set global time_zone = '+8:00';    show variables ...

Sat Nov 11 02:49:00 CST 2017 0 1936
spring jdbc 查询结果返回对象、对象列表

首先,需要了解spring jdbc查询,有三种回调方式来处理查询的结果集。可以参考 使用spring的JdbcTemplate进行查询的三种回调方式的比较,写得还不错。 1.返回对象(queryForObject) 有两种办法,即两个容易混淆的方法: 第一种方法是需要一个 ...

Fri Jan 06 03:32:00 CST 2017 0 21529
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M